In the effort to find stocks with high growth potential, many investors use organized methods that join detailed chart study with basic business momentum. One well-known method is the plan made famous by Mark Minervini, which centers on locating stocks in strong upward moves that also have improving company foundations. This plan is not for locating low-priced stocks, but instead for finding market leaders early in their large price gains. A central instrument in this structure is the Minervini Trend Template, a group of chart rules made to confirm a stock is in a clear, lasting upward move. To better focus the hunt for notable chances, this chart filter can be joined with an emphasis on strong business momentum, looking for firms that are not only moving well on charts but are also showing better profit and sales increases than similar companies. This joined view tries to separate securities that have both the chart momentum and the basic reason for more growth.

Checking the Trend Template Fit

The Minervini Trend Template is made on a base of particular moving average arrangements and price movement traits that together show a stock is in a solid, institution-led upward move. For a stock to pass, it must meet several conditions about its place compared to important moving averages and its nearness to new peaks. Using the given information, Glaukos Corp shows a fit with many of these important chart measures:

  • Price Over Important Averages: The stock's last price of $112.77 trades over its 150-day moving average ($101.34) and its 200-day moving average ($99.93). This is a basic need, showing the long-term move is positive.
  • Moving Average Arrangement: The 50-day moving average ($112.12) is placed over both the 150-day and 200-day averages. Also, the 150-day average is over the 200-day average. This order of shorter-term averages over longer-term ones is a standard sign of a sound, set upward move.
  • Nearness to Peaks: A central idea of the Minervini view is to concentrate on strength, not low points. GKOS's present price is about 54% over its 52-week low of $73.16, showing major recovery and momentum. While it is not inside the exact 25% of its 52-week peak ($130.23), its place far from the lows still shows a large upward path.
  • Relative Strength: The stock's ChartMill Relative Strength (CRS) score of 72.71 shows it has done better than about 73% of the whole market in terms of price action over the past year. Minervini stresses putting money in market leaders, and a growing or high relative strength score is a central sign of such leadership.

These points together indicate that GKOS is working inside what Minervini would call a "Stage 2" climb,a time of continued upward move,which is the main stage where his plan aims to invest.

Studying Strong Business Momentum

The chart view is only one part of the story. The Minervini plan greatly values basic business improvement, stating that the largest stock gains are nearly always backed by solid and getting better profit and sales increases. This is where the "High Growth Momentum" part becomes relevant. The given basic data for Glaukos shows several areas of clear momentum:

  • Strong Sales Growth: The company is showing notable top-line growth. Year-over-year sales growth for the last reported quarter was 35.7%, and the trailing twelve-month (TTM) sales growth is at 32.3%. This steady, high-rate sales increase is a primary sign of market share gains and business action.
  • Profit Path: While the company is not yet regularly profitable on a net income basis (EPS TTM is -$0.90), the direction in its bottom-line results shows clear betterment. Earnings per share growth on a TTM basis is given as 52.6%, and the recent quarterly EPS growth numbers are strongly positive (30.0%, 42.9%, 53.8% over the last three quarters). This pattern of major loss reduction,or speed toward profit,is a strong basic reason that can draw investor focus.
  • Estimate Changes: The data shows a 0.24% upward change in the average analyst sales estimate for the next year over the past three months. While small, positive changes can signal growing analyst belief in the company's growth story. It is important, however, that next-year EPS estimates have been changed down notably, which may reflect spending phase costs or other points that need watching.

For an investor focused on growth, this mix of fast sales growth and a quickly bettering profit trend is key. It gives the basic reason for the stock's chart strength, suggesting the price movement is backed by real business momentum.

Chart Condition and Setup Overview

A look at the given chart study report gives a fair, current review of GKOS's chart condition. The report gives the stock a chart score of 5 out of 10, calling its overall chart condition average. The long and short-term moves are both called neutral. On the positive side, the report agrees with the stock's relative strength, noting it does better than 72% of the market and 83% of its health care equipment peers. It also sees the stock is trading near the top of its recent one-month range.

However, the report's setup quality score is a low 3, showing that from a strict pattern view, the stock does not now give a high-quality, low-risk entry point. The summary says that "price movement has been a little bit too volatile to find a nice entry and exit point" and proposes waiting for a period of less movement. This is a key practical point for a trader; while the stock may fit many trend template rules, the best Minervini entry often comes after a volatility squeeze pattern (VCP), giving a exact turning point. Investors interested in the long-term growth story might see moves down to support areas (noted in the report at ~$100.31-$100.37 and ~$97.02) as possible zones of interest, while strict followers of the plan may wait for a more clear setup to appear.
